Are Your Recruiters Socially Competent - Blogging4Jobs

Are Your Recruiters Socially Competent - Blogging4Jobs 3 KEYS TO BEING A SOCIALLY COMPETENT  Recruiter As recruiting leaders, you are most likely involved in somewhat regular conversations about social and its role in recruiting. Those conversations may revolve around Facebook pages, job feeds, vendors and tapping into your employees social networks. The convos might also include measuring success, ROI and ensuring that proper processes and procedures are in place. But, are any of you talking about recruiter competency in the social space? At the end of the day, you can roll out all sorts of platforms, guidelines and training, but if your recruiters arent competent in the execution, it could all be for naught. 3 KEYS TO BEING A SOCIALLY COMPETENT  Recruiter Knowledge, interest and time. KIT. Do your recruiters have the necessary tools in their kit to be socially competent? Knowledge Have you recruiters properly set up their social profiles? Do they really know how to use the different platforms? Can they create compelling messages to job seekers that encourage an action or response? Have you provided the in-depth, necessary training to enable your recruiters to be successful? Is there more that you can do to educate your recruiters experienced and novice to be more proficient? Interest Are your recruiters even interested in using social tools to source, brand and engage? Or, is another item on the to-do list that ends up overwhelming your team? Time Do your recruiters have the time it takes to dedicate to social? Can they commit to daily social sourcing? Do they have a few hours a week to spend cultivating a social presence? .ai-rotate {position: relative;} .ai-rotate-hidden {visibility: hidden;} .ai-rotate-hidden-2 {position: absolute; top: 0; left: 0; width: 100%; height: 100%;} .ai-list-data, .ai-ip-data, .ai-fallback, .ai-list-block {visibility: hidden; position: absolute; width: 50%; height: 1px; z-index: -9999;} Knowledge without interest or time is a dead-end street. Knowledge and interest without carving out time is a set up waiting to fail. CONNECT WITH YOUR RECRUITERS I would encourage you to connect with your recruiters the people who are expected to carry out much of your social recruiting strategies. Ask them to rank their knowledge of social recruiting: would they consider themselves a novice, moderate or expert? What about their interest level: are they passionate or luke-warm at best? And, how much time do they have to dedicate to the efforts: none, maybe two hours or an opportunity every day? What are your thoughts about this idea of recruiter competency? How to Amplify Your Brand Voice With Employee Advocacy

How to Amplify Your Brand Voice With Employee Advocacy Although most businesses now realise that social media can play a significant role in their marketing and employer branding, few recognise they value of their employees and the role that they can play in the businesses social media efforts. The average person has 5 social media accounts, so it is highly likely that employees are already very active online and would be willing to become a social media advocate for the company. Not only are your employees a more trustworthy source than official company accounts, but getting them involved in sharing brand related content can also expand your reach significantly. Everyone Social have put together an infographic looking at how businesses can  amplify their brand voice by encouraging employees to be vocal on social media. Heres how your company could benefit from employee advocacy: How are businesses using social media? On average companies post:  1-2 times a day on Facebook;  4-15 times a day on Twitter and  20 times per month on LinkedIn 50% of employees are post about their employer on social media and of this 50% 1/3 of the posts are positive  39% of employers ask their employees to keep an eye out for social media posts about the company How are  employers helping employees to get involved on social media? 13% provide employees with 1 or more social media account 35% provide access to social media at work 55% of employers provide readily available tools for employees to use on social media How can social media affect employee engagement? Employees with the most extensive online networks are 7% more productive than their colleagues Employees of socially engaged companies are 20% more likely to stay at the organisation What are the benefits of employee advocacy on social media? Content shared by employees receives 8x more engagement than that shared by official brand channels Brand messages reach 561% further when shared by employees, than by official brand channels 90% of consumers said that they trust social media and word-of-mouth recommendations by friend and family more than other advertising. Black Friday and Employee Recruitment - Personal Branding Blog - Stand Out In Your Career

Black Friday and Employee Recruitment - Personal Branding Blog - Stand Out In Your Career All employees want to recruit the best candidate and often, small business owners complain that they cannot convince talented candidates to work for them. Well, as a small business owner, did you ever think of applying Black Friday to your recruitment? If you are asking how you are going to do this, here is how. If you ever looked at Black Friday offers carefully, you can see that all of them have a value proposition. Some of them are limited quantity or for a limited time and others have a special discount that make everyone think that it is not an everyday price. As a result, people hurry up and run to the store to buy their desired items. Now, let’s look at your company’s recruiting in terms of Black Friday. Do your job ads have a value proposition? Does it make the majority of job seekers open your job post and then, apply? If yes, that is great. Then, your company is a desired company and your recruitment department is doing its job right. If not, you should reevaluate your job posts and the message they are communicating to the job seekers. Talented candidates constantly look for new knowledge, skills and experience. That is why they generally look for another job. If you want to attract these candidates, you should market your job posts like you are marketing a Black Friday offer. First, you can start by giving a name to your recruitment initiative such as Management Trainee Program, Fast Track Management Program or College Hiring Program for new graduates. This will help you establish a brand for your recruitment effort.  Then, try to focus on the advancement theme on your job posts. Don’t forget that everybody has a career dream and as an employer, you should help fulfill that dream.   Otherwise, talented hires look for other employees which will help them fulfill their dreams. Finally, promote your job posts wisely. Try to get inside information about where your desired candidates look for job posts. You don’t need to post your job openings in all of the job sites. The important point is choosing the ones that will bring you the candidates you want. Also, run an employee referral program. Encourage your employees to refer candidates for job openings. In addition, you can advertise your job openings for internal hiring as well. It is always easier to train an internal employee for a new job compared to someone completely new to the company.

How To Use Disagreements to Build Stronger Teams

How To Use Disagreements to Build Stronger Teams Because I facilitate team sessions for a living, I’ve seen lots of team interactions. All kinds of drama, some shouting and tears, but also lots of laughter, joy, and bold action. Much about teamwork has been researched, dissected, and discussed. Yet lately, I’ve been thinking a lot about an unexplored topic: how to get team members to disagree. What do you do as a team member, if, after all the discussion and debate, the hours the team talked about a new direction, plan, or policy, you still disagree? What I see happen on most teams is acquiescence giving in or just going along. It’s hard to know the line between sticking to your views and aligning with the team. Are you a bad team player if you don’t agree? For a long time, I have facilitated team problem-solving sessions in the same way: 1.         First explore the issue from all sides, uncovering a comprehensive view of the current state and root causes 2.         Next, brainstorm options and agree on a broad path forward 3.         And finally develop recommendations and specific action plans During the first two steps, team members share their views, voice concerns, ask probing questions, debate, and discuss. I ensure people know it’s a safe environment to dissent and challenge. And then, at a certain point, when we have brainstormed and kicked around options, we agree on a future state. Then we move into action planning.   Once plans and next steps are identified, well, I deem the team session a home run. We have moved from chaos into order, from theory into action. It always feels like a triumph of team process and alignment. Until it suddenly didn’t. At a recent team session, I didn’t like the feeling in the room at the end of step 3. Everyone had dutifully done their breakout work, devising strong, meaty action plans. Yet, the energy was all off. Team members seemed deflated instead of enthused. So I decided to do a check in. I asked everyone to show, using hand signals from fist to five, how they felt about bringing this plan forward to the organization.   Here’ the fist to five criteria I used: Fist = over my dead body 1 â€" 2 = serious concerns and not really on board 3 = I can live with it but…. 4= feeling pretty darn good 5 = can’t wait to get started Based on the quality of the work they had done to develop strong plans and recommendations, I expected all 4s and 5s. What I saw around the room astounded me.   Responses ranged from 2.5 â€" 5. I couldn’t believe there were still 3 team members with serious â€" stop the presses â€" concerns. As we started talking about it, here’s some of what I heard: “I still don’t believe this project should take precedence over our other priorities. And I don’t think we can get those and this done.” “I don’t feel we have proven the ROI. I’m not convinced it will really impact our goals.” I was panicked. All eyes were looking at me with a “Now what?” stare, especially the team leader. Instead of trying to fix things, I decided to ask some questions. I asked: “Why did you do the action planning if you still didn’t agree with the solution?” “What made you feel that you couldn’t say this earlier in the day? What held you back?” I learned that team members felt swept along by the process, guilty about not going along with what the team leader so obviously wanted, and eager to demonstrate alignment and teamwork. We ended the day in a completely different place than I expected. We decided to delay any further action on this project until it could be evaluated in the context of the larger portfolio. It was disconcerting to me. If I hadn’t checked in when I had, we would have ended the day with timelines and actions that 1/3 of the team didn’t believe in, and I (and the team leader) would have left with a false sense of unity. I wonder how often this unspoken disagreement happens on teams? Maybe all the time? So what can you do to ensure team members don’t just give up too early. Here are 3 ideas you can try. 1. Create real space for disagreement. Ask good questions to promote speaking up such as: What’s a contrary view? What have we not considered? Why would this fail? What’s the one thing holding you back from full support? What has not been said that we should discuss before we move on? 2. Check in on how people are feeling. We are focused in business on facts and data. And while we shouldn’t make our decisions solely using “gut feel,” we shouldn’t ignore our intuition and our inner voice which usually expresses our fears and concerns. 3. If you are the team leader, make sure you are not skewing the direction based on your personal views. If you have already decided, then tell the team. But if you really want to hear unbiased views, share yours last. Don’t get me wrong. I love building team alignment and collaboration. But I also think we need to work just as hard to promote divergent thinking and unpopular views. Build a stronger team by getting good at disagreeing! How to Stop Wasting Time at Work - Personal Branding Blog - Stand Out In Your Career

How to Stop Wasting Time at Work - Personal Branding Blog - Stand Out In Your Career It is so easy to waste time at work through checking social media, chatting with coworkers or doing unnecessary things. As a result, at the end of the day you accomplish nothing and feel unproductive. Therefore, in order to spend your day more meaningfully and achieve your goals, implement the below steps to your daily routine. 1.  Make a to-do list: When you come to the office every day, make yourself a to-do list and try to finish that entire list at the end of the day. Keep it small and realistic at the start. Make sure you prioritize your tasks according to their importance. When you have difficulty concentrating, work on the low intensity tasks such as printing something or archiving your files. Therefore, you can stay productive even if your concentration is low. Do not forget to revise your list during the day as new tasks show up. 2.  Stop Checking Your Emails Randomly: The email message that is popping up on your computer screen can create urgency for many to check their inboxes constantly. Checking your emails frequently can make you waste your time, since you need to refocus on the task that you have been working on. Unless you are truly waiting for an important email, you should schedule specific times to check your emails such as at the morning, after lunch and in the afternoon. The same holds for your smart phone messages and voicemails as well. 3.  Do not multi-task: If you are working on your emails at the same time you are working on your task, then it will take you more time to complete both of them compared to working on them one-by-one.   As a result, you will waste your time. The reason of this is that multi-tasking divides your attention between tasks and since each task gets less attention, you need more time to finish them. Work on one task at a time and move on to the next one when you are done. 4.  Divide Your Time into Chunks: Group similar activities together and don’t bounce from one activity to the other without finishing the one you are working on. For example, you can use your mornings to reply all of the emails from the previous day and after finishing your emails, you can do your meetings or phone calls, then, you can work on your project and finally, you can check your emails again. Do not forget that when you group together similar activities, your brain works faster.

Online Identity Are You a Digital Dud or a Digital Rock Star

Online Identity Are You a Digital Dud or a Digital Rock Star Last week I presented a seminar called Career Branding: Building Your Brand Online and Offline to members of the New York Society of Security Analysts (NYSSA). During the presentation, a member of the audience asked Why do I really need to have an online presence? I get asked this question quite often and I can appreciate the skepticism many have towards putting information about themselves online. But the reality is that many recruiters and hiring authorities are searching for candidates online and many are making screening decisions based on the information they do (or do not) find.  According to a 2009 Execunet survey, 86% of recruiters surveyed do a “Google” search on candidates and reject 44% of candidates based on what they find out about them online. So doesnt it make sense to take control of your online identity and manage your electronic footprint? Here are 4 questions that every person interested in managing their career should ask themselves.  Do I exist online?  Is m y identity possibly being confused with others who have the same name?Is the information about me online relevant to my professional identity and is it accurate?Is there anything damaging about me online that a hiring manager could uncover?  Take a few minutes to perform an online identity checkup by putting your name in quotes into a major search engine. If your online presence is next to nothing, confusing, irrelevant, or detrimental to your career, consider branding or re-branding yourself using tools such as LinkedIn, ZoomInfo, and GoogleMe to improve your career brand and better represent your unique value proposition.

Career Testing Tools-Work Preference Inventory - Hallie Crawford

Career Testing Tools-Work Preference Inventory Heres another good, quick online career test. Its 24 questions and only takes about 15 minutes to complete. It tests for the type of work tasks you prefer to work on. Work Preference Inventory. Again, as I mentioned in a previous post, I don’t recommend using these tests alone. Whenever I recommend a career testing tool to a client, like the MAPP or Rockport, I let them know they need to use the test results in conjunction with a coaching session or two. This is because each test measures specific things about you like your skills, motivations, or work style for example. What they typically don’t do is provide a complete, comprehensive picture of all of the components you need to consider in defining/determining the ideal career for you. To get that, you really need to have a coaching session with a certified career coach who knows what to look for in defining the ideal career path. The career tests I recommend are: MAPP, Rockport and True Colors. Good luck! Hallie

Wide-Format Printer Buying Guide

Wide-Format Printer Buying Guideleistungspunkt SeventyFur/Shutterstock Its always a good idea to buy the most flexible wide-format printer your company can afford so that it can fulfill a variety of roles in your business. Butwith all the things wide printers can do, this notion can only go so far.Beyond the basics (banners, posters and in-store marketing materials), there are several types of jobs that require specialized equipment to get the job done quickly and efficiently. Whether its creating photorealistic images for a product introduction, outdoor materials for a store opening or printing on fabrics for a fashion show, you need to use a wide printer thats been designed for a specific task. Editors note Looking for a wide-format printer? We can help you choose the one thats right for you. Use the questionnaire below to have our sister site, BuyerZone, provide you with information from a variety of vendors for freeTo start, most wide-format marketing materials can be created with a workhorse printer capable of printing many different types of materials. With the ability to apply between four and six different inks onto a roll of media between 24 and 54 inches, it can do everything from store end caps to a wall banner that screams SALE.Take Canons imagePROGRAF TX-4000, a $6,500 printer that spools out prints up to 44 inches wide. It uses five pigment-based inks that are sprayed through more than 15,000 nozzles for an overall resolution of 2,400 x 1,200 dots per inch (dpi). In plus-rechnen to the expected variety of matte and glossy papers, the TX-4000 is versatile enough to print on polypropylene and vinyl, although its output will not weather well outdoors.Credit Canon USA Inc.Thats where a dedicated printer for outdoor materials comes in. Rather than using inks designed for indoor use, these printers use formulations that are either solvent-or latex-based. The former melts the surface to seep in, while the latter creates a str ong bond with the materials surface. The result is a print that can live outdoors through rain, bright sunlight and wind without significantly bleaching, cracking or fading.For example, the HP Latex R2000+ can work with stock of up to 98.4 inches, can print with nine different latex-based inks and has huge 5-liter ink cartridges that can cut costs. The R2000+ can print on anything from poster paper and vinyl to polyester, canvas and polypropylene. Interested in wide-format printers? Check out our reviews on our sister site Business.com.Credit HP Development Company LPAt more than $200,000, its a lot of printer, but its output is sharp and glossy, perfect for billboards, event graphics, bus shelters and outdoor posters. By contrast, the $55,000 Roland VersaUV LEC-540s inks use a mixture of solvents that penetrate the medias surface forming a tight bond. While Rolands Eco-UV inks come in cyan, magenta, yellow, black and white, the printer can also apply a protective clear top coat.Cre dit Roland DGA CorporationOn the downside, the solvent ink requires a blast of ultraviolet light to cure the image, which slows the process. The prints emerge dry to the touch, flexible and fused to the substrates surface. The 54-inch wide printer is just as good at making outdoor banners that hold up well in the wind or for stick-on appliques that need to adhere to a curved surface.When it comes to making photorealistic prints, the more colors the printer can marshal, the richer, sharper and more vibrant the output. While a poster printed on a basic wide-format printer might appear OK, next to one created by a photorealistic printer, it would look crude and garish.With the ability to spray up to nine inks onto 44-inch wide media, the $3,200 Epson SureColor P8000 can work with the choice of four different blacks, cyan and light cyan, vivid and light magenta, yellow, orange, green and violet. The ink can be purchased in 150-, 350- and 700-ml cartridges for a good mix of flexibility a nd economy.Credit Epson America Inc.The best part is that the P8000s 2880 x 1440 dpi resolution translates into big prints with pinpoint accuracy, smooth gradients and rich colors. In fact, when museums need to print digital material for exhibitions, they often choose the P8000 for its faithful color reproduction and assortment of media.With a traditional loom, getting a custom fabric take weeks if not months and can cost thousands of dollars in setup fees. You can produce your own textiles in an hour by either printing directly onto the fabric or using the two-step dye sublimation process.Happily, Mimakis TS300P-1800and TX 300P-1800 fraternal twins do both. The TS300P uses a two-step dye sublimation process, while the TX300P prints right onto a variety of fabrics. Both are good for a variety of textiles, including fashion, drapery, personalized sports uniforms and instant flags. They cost $32,000 for the TS300P and $36,000 for the TX300P.Credit ITNHWhile the two printers share a co mmon print engine, they differ in the details. For instance, the TS300Ps maximum print width is 76.4 inches while the TX300P maxes out at 74 inches. On the other hand, the TX300P can deliver 1,440 dpi graphics while the TS300P is limited to 1,080 dpi printing.The big differentiator is ink, with the TX300Ps textile pigment ink available in black, two magentas, two blues and yellow. By contrast, the TS300P can also use fluorescent pink and yellow inks that really stand out for vibrant designs. Both come in two-liter containers for quick and economical refills.While large companies that do a lot of wide printing can afford to take a one of each approach, smaller ones will find it hard to justify getting specialty printers. The best strategy is to get the printers required for the high volume use and farm out those specialty print jobs that cant be done in-house.
